Method
Prep
Rice
Ensure rice is cooked, cooled, and chilled (preferably refrigerated overnight). Break up any clumps with a fork so grains are separate.
Vegetables & Protein
Dice carrots and red pepper into small uniform pieces. Thaw peas and corn if frozen. Mince garlic and ginger. Slice scallions, separating white and green parts (reserve green parts for garnish). If using tofu, press and cube. If using shrimp, pat dry. If using cooked meat, shred into bite-sized pieces.
Sauce
In a small bowl combine soy sauce, oyster sauce, fish sauce (if using), cooking wine, stock/water, sugar and sesame oil. Stir to dissolve sugar and set aside.
Cook
Add the white parts of the scallions, diced carrot and red bell pepper. Stir-fry for 1–2 minutes until they begin to soften but still have color.
Push vegetables to the side of the wok. Add remaining 1 tablespoon oil to the empty area and add the tofu cubes (if using). Let sear without moving for 30–45 seconds, then toss to brown on other sides, about 1–2 minutes total. Remove tofu to a bowl and set aside.
If using shrimp, add shrimp to the wok and stir-fry until pink and just cooked through, about 1–2 minutes. Remove and set aside with tofu. If using cooked meat, add it now to heat through for 30–45 seconds and set aside.
Pour the prepared sauce evenly over the rice. Toss thoroughly to distribute color and seasoning. If rice seems dry, add the 2 tablespoons stock/water gradually to help loosen and create slight gloss.
Taste and season with white pepper and salt as needed. Stir in remaining sesame oil for aroma.
Finish & Serve
Turn off heat and stir in sliced green parts of scallions. Transfer fried rice to a warmed serving platter or individual bowls.
Garnish with toasted sesame seeds and fresh cilantro if using. Serve with lime wedges on the side for a bright finish.
Leftovers: cool quickly, refrigerate within 2 hours in an airtight container for up to 3 days. Reheat in a hot skillet with a splash of water or stock to loosen.
